The Medina Masonic Temple and Medina Theater in Medina, Ohio was the first movie theater in Medina. Constructed in 1924 this two screen auditorium operated from 1937 until its closure in 2000.[2] It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 2002.[1]

The city of Medina purchased the building in July 2015[2] and voted to demolish it in July 2016 to make a gravel parking lot. The area has since been converted to a parking garage.[3]
